How Combining Human and Artificial Intelligence Might Be the Winning Combination

A lot gets written and debated about Artificial Intelligence these days. In that context, the recent report by the US National Science and Technology Council ‘Preparing for the future of Artificial Intelligence‘ is a must read.


the-future-of-aiOne area that has struck me in particular is the reference to exceptional performance of the combination of human and artificial intelligence when is comes to pattern recognition. An example: “In one recent study, given images of lymph node cells, and asked to determine whether or not the cells contained cancer, an AI-based approach had a 7.5 percent error rate, where a human pathologist had a 3.5 percent error rate; a combined approach, using both AI and human input, lowered the error rate to 0.5 percent, representing an 85 percent reduction in error.


It seems increasingly that this combination of two different perspectives, ours and the other one we are creating using Artificial Intelligence, could open us new frontiers. Artificial Intelligence in that sense seems rather a useful tool to broaden our perspectives and capabilities.
